Pros

Good entry point into logistics and data center operations. Employees often mention gaining hands-on experience with inventory management, shipping/receiving, asset tracking, and logistics processes that can help build a supply chain or IT operations career. Decent work-life balance. Logistics Associate reviews on Indeed show work-life balance scoring higher than other categories (around 3.6/5). Exposure to major tech clients. Many Milestone logistics positions support large technology companies and data centers, which can look good on a résumé

Cons

Limited advancement opportunities. Job security and career growth receive some of the lowest ratings among review categories. Contractor environment. Because Milestone often works through client contracts, your experience can depend heavily on the client site you're assigned to. Some employees report feeling disconnected from corporate leadership.
